I went to see Dr. Graham today. He is a leading author on the raw movement. He wrote a book called 80/10/10. His whole principal is that we should be eating meals that are 80 carbohydrates, 10% protein, 10% fat. The typical standard American diet is roughly as I can recall he said, 70% carbs, 15 proteins, and 15 fats. Then he went on to reveal that most raw foodist are 60% carbs, 20% protein, and 20% fat, considering all the oils, nuts, and avocados we consume. I believe him.
